Problem
My client Carlos purchased this downtown Albuquerque loft as his first home after finishing his PhD. The location and building were both ideal, but the loft itself was a bit rough around the edges. Carlos is a minimalist and loved the open concept of the space, but the kitchen and living areas felt dark and cold despite the large windows. The kitchen was small and very basic, the walls had a yellowish tone and the floors had literal holes in the concrete. How do we make this industrial space feel more like a home?
Process
Carlos enlisted The Vibe to blend the industrial bones of the space with his preferred 'japandi' style. Japandi is the fusion of both Japanese and Scandinavian minimalism and materiality. Warm woods, natural materials, lots of texture, and an earthy color palette are some of the key elements that we used to create the japandi vibe. On this project, the client wanted to learn to do some of the remodeling work himself and he did an amazing job! The first order of business was to fix the floors and install a new type of flooring that felt good underfoot. Along with painting the walls and all the trim a neutral white, changing the flooring type made an enormous impact on the overall feeling of the space. Next, we tackled the kitchen. Carlos did all of the demo work as well as installing the new cabinets. Choosing to go with IKEA base cabinets with bespoke fronts freed up a tremendous amount of space in the budget. The custom white oak fronts were created in North Dakota by the Scherr company and look stunning. We chose a textural and neutral backsplash and quartz countertops to bring light to the space. Carlos installed custom lighting from Etsy for both task and ambient purposes. Finally, we designed a rolling kitchen island made with reclaimed wood from the local shop Rangewood Reclaimers and had a quartz top put on it for additional countertop prep and entertaining space.
